Cherish the Earth's Mineral Resources and Promote the Comprehensive Utilization of Iron Tailings

Article Preview

Abstract:

With the increasing amount of tailings, it has brought many serious problems like take up a lot of land, construction and maintenance tailings reservoirs must be consume a large amount of money. The stockpiled tailings is not only bring drawbacks, but also bring huge economic benefits for us. For example, recycling of useful components contained in the tailings, or use the tailings as a whole. This article introduction the tailings status, utilization and point out direction of future development of tailings utilization.
